Re: Bynum 2nd best on the Lakers?
Gasol is more polished, but he can't impact a game the way Bynum can. It's like during the 3-peat era when we used to face the Spurs. We all knew Duncan was the more skilled player than Shaq, but that didn't matter, because Shaq was too big, too strong, too unstoppable.
In the same way, Gasol is more skilled, but he can't impact a game the way Bynum can. Gasol will beat you with a pretty little jump hook. Bynum will jam the ball down your throat and break your hand if you try to block it. He gets in there with the big boys and mixes it up.
So in terms of impact, Bynum is the clear #2 guy on offense. And I would say he's the #1 guy on defense. In terms of pure skills, I would put him behind Kobe and Pau, and on some nights Odom.

Re: Bynum 2nd best on the Lakers?
Honestly, before we got Gasol I said there is no way I'd ever trade Bynum for Gasol straight up and I'd have to stick with that thought even after landing Gasol. Bynum's presence is just immense on the floor. Gasol on the other hand is an offensive stud. Keep in mind the Gasol we saw in these playoffs wasn't the same Gasol in Memphis. In Memphis Gasol had so much more depth to his game than he's shown so far; don't forget he's only been a Laker for 5 months. As far as what he's done in the triangle in limited time, he's a genius.
They both have such a great impact on our team, Bynum on both ends equally and Gasol is nasty on offense; and at PF Gasol may end up being a beast. If you had a gun to my head and I had to pick one to remain a Laker, I'd have to pick Bynum just because he completely changes the complexion of our defense. No offense to Gasol, but our defense just was not the same once Bynum went out.
All in all though, as it is having both players on the squad I'd have to say it's 2a and 2b with Bynum and Gasol, we're going to be in for a real treat next year. They both got different strengths they'll bring to the squad and it's just going to be nuts to have Gasol, Bynum, and Odom as our front line.
